Q.

An electron in hydrogen and one in a singly ionised helium atom are excited to the state n = 2. A photon is emitted when these electrons iump back to the ground state in each case. Then

a

energy of photon is same in both

b

radiations emitted by helium atom are shifted towards the red as compared to radiation from hydrogen atom

c

radiation emitted by helium are shifted towards the violet as compared to radiation from hydrogen atom

d

there is no definite relation between the radiations emitted by the two atoms

answer is C.

Detailed Solution

we know that v∝Z2Hence the corresponding lines from helium are more energetic (shifted toward the violet) compared to those from hydrogen,
